How did the u.s. government attempt to reverse the effects of the great depression

One way in which the U.S. government change its response to the Great Depression after the election of Franklin Roosevelt was that "B. It adopted an economic approach based on spending rather than saving," since it was clear that the government needed to "stimulate" the economy aggressively.
